Dreaming about scared dogs can be a powerful and often unsettling experience. To fully understand the significance of such dreams, we must delve into the symbolism of dogs and the emotions they evoke.

Dogs are commonly associated with loyalty, protection, and companionship in our waking lives. When they appear as scared in a dream, it can signify a sense of vulnerability or lack of security in your life. The dog's fear might be reflecting your own unaddressed anxieties or concerns that you have been suppressing. It is important to acknowledge these emotions and consider what aspects of your life may be causing this underlying stress.

In some cases, a scared dog in a dream could represent a part of yourself that feels threatened or overwhelmed. This could pertain to challenges at work, difficulties in relationships, or personal fears that you have yet to confront. By recognizing the symbolism, you can start to identify and address the root causes of your anxieties.

Additionally, the context of the dream plays a crucial role in interpreting its meaning. For instance, if the scared dog is being chased or attacked by another animal, it might indicate feelings of being pursued or harassed in your waking life. Alternatively, if you are the one trying to comfort or protect the scared dog, this could symbolize your desire to help and support others who are experiencing fear or distress.

It is also worth considering the emotional state of the dreamer upon waking up. If you feel anxious or disturbed after the dream, it might be a sign that there are unresolved issues in your life that need attention. On the other hand, if you wake up feeling more at ease, it could suggest that the dream has helped you process and release some of your pent-up fears.
